fi 脚本语言226


fi 是一个独特的脚本语言,旨在提高开发人员的生产力,尤其是在处理文本数据时。它由 Facebook 于 2012 年推出,最初用于处理公司庞大的日志文件。

fi 的主要优势之一是其简洁的语法。与其他脚本语言相比,例如 Python 和 JavaScript,fi 的语法更简洁,代码更易于阅读和理解。这有助于提高开发人员的效率,并减少在调试和维护代码上花费的时间。

fi 最常用的领域之一是文本处理。它提供了一个强大的正则表达式引擎,可以轻松地从文本数据中提取和处理模式。fi 还包括一个丰富的函数库,用于处理字符串、文件和数据结构。

除了文本处理之外,fi 还可用作通用编程语言。它支持模块化编程、函数式编程和面向对象编程。这使得 fi 适用于各种任务,包括 Web 开发、数据分析和系统管理。

这里有一些 fi 的主要功能:* 简洁的语法,易于学习和使用
* 强大的正则表达式引擎,用于文本处理
* 丰富的函数库,用于处理字符串、文件和数据结构
* 支持模块化编程、函数式编程和面向对象编程
* 跨平台支持,可在 Windows、macOS 和 Linux 系统上运行

以下是一些使用 fi 的示例:```fi
# 从文本文件中提取所有电子邮件地址
emails = fi.read_file("").grep(r"\b[A-Za-z0-9._%+-]+@[A-Za-z0-9.-]+\.[A-Z|a-z]{2,}\b")
# 计算文本文件中单词的频率
word_counts = fi.read_file("").split().group_by().count()
# 使用正则表达式将 HTML 文档解析为 AST
html_ast = fi.read_file("").grep(r"").map(lambda tag: (""))
```

如果您正在寻找一种简单易学且功能强大的脚本语言,用于处理文本数据或进行通用编程,那么 fi 是一个不错的选择。它简洁的语法、强大的正则表达式引擎和丰富的函数库使其非常适合各种任务。

2024-12-28


上一篇:Procomm 脚本语言:自动化通信的强大工具

下一篇:脚本语言输出:深入了解控制台和命令行